The Economic Imperative: Hard Numbers Behind AI Virtual Staging
Recent market analysis from Zillow Research Group reveals that professionally staged properties sell 73% faster compared to homes presented without enhancements. Conventionally, physical staging costs between $3,000-$10,000 for a standard home, representing a significant financial barrier for many agents and sellers.
In comparison, AI-powered virtual staging typically costs $29-$99 per room, delivering a cost reduction of roughly 97% compared to physical staging services.
Based on data from the American Society of Home Stagers and Redesigners, 82% of buyers’ agents indicate that visual enhancements help for potential purchasers to imagine the property as their potential residence. With digital AI enhancement, this visualization advantage is attained at a significantly lower investment.
Industry reports from CoreLogic demonstrate that properties with AI enhancements generate 61% more views on listing services than non-enhanced listings, resulting in a larger pool of potential buyers and faster transactions.

Real-World Integration: Overcoming Barriers in AI Virtual Staging
Despite its benefits, successful deployment of AI virtual staging encounters various obstacles. Visual input specifications represent a significant issue, with many digital platforms requiring professional-grade images to function optimally.
Analysis performed by Property Marketing Alliance demonstrates that best digital enhancement outcomes require photographs at baseline quality of 4000 x 3000 pixels with proper lighting. Listings captured with inadequate equipment see a 64% increased error frequency by digital enhancement platforms.
Technical limitations still create challenges for certain property types. Unusual architectural features including non-rectangular rooms often perplex current AI algorithms, causing a higher rate of inaccuracies that demand professional adjustment.
Legal considerations constitute a further adoption hurdle. At present, 83% of housing organizations demand transparent communication that listing images have been virtually staged, based on National Association of Realtors.
Omission of notification AI alterations potentially causes regulatory problems, with potential penalties spanning $1,000-$10,000 per violation in certain jurisdictions.

Adoption Roadmap: Best Practices for Real Estate Professionals
For real estate professionals seeking to utilize AI virtual staging productively, market specialists suggest a structured approach.
To begin, conducting a return on investment evaluation is crucial. Although digital enhancement costs significantly less than traditional approaches, greatest impact necessitates budgeting for quality photography. Successful brokerages usually invest $300-$500 per home for professional photography to provide superior digital enhancement outcomes.
Next, establishing clear policies for disclosure and transparency concerning virtual staging prevents potential legal issues. Leading brokerages uniformly add clear notices on every listing document indicating that photographs are virtually staged.
Third, strategic integration of digital enhancement with supporting systems enhances effectiveness. Industry metrics from Real Estate Digital Transformation Initiative indicates that homes showcasing digital staging and virtual walkthroughs produce 86% greater genuine interest than homes employing single solutions.
In conclusion, preserving actual listings in shape that matches virtual presentations is still crucial. Prospective purchasers who tour homes assuming environments matching virtual representations but encounter major differences demonstrate a 68% lower likelihood of submitting proposals, according to Real Estate Consumer Experience Survey.
